Output 277626fca91f7ae1c017e4ecc4efeb02af0950c856a023cc574399d23e629036:74

value
77121
script pubkey
OP_0 OP_PUSHBYTES_20 bdd87ec8f04be8eb209cbb50bc6fe0301ca5891e
address
bc1qhhv8aj8sf05wkgyuhdgtcmlqxqw2tzg7eh54cl
transaction
277626fca91f7ae1c017e4ecc4efeb02af0950c856a023cc574399d23e629036
confirmations
6947
spent
true